How To Get Your Body Naturally Burning Fat

     We are coming into a new age of fitness and exercise where a persons "metabolic fitness" is considered more important then simply 'burning calories' during an exercise session.

Less emphasis is on body weight or even body fat and more emphasis is being placed on having a healthy metabolism - becoming 'metabolically fit'. This means that the hormonal environment in the body is geared towards burning fat for energy rather than storing it and becoming a health risk.

One of the main hormones involved is the chemical messenger insulin whose job is to direct sugar in the blood into the muscle cells to be burnt up for energy. If the body becomes resistant to this hormone sugar remains in the circulating blood and ends up in places where it shouldn't be causing damage to cells, tissues and organs.

Having healthy metabolic fitness means that the body will have excellent glucose tolerance, normal blood pressure and a healthy blood lipid (fats) profile which means it there will be a lower risk for heart disease and diabetes.

The major causes of insulin resistance are lack of enough muscle building and maintaining activity and a diet high in refined sugar, high in fat and low in fiber. This is of course the standard diet of much of the world's population so explains why this condition is very common. Although an overweight person is more likely to have this condition people who are not overweight can have it as well. An estimated one-fourth of Americans are insulin resistant and do not realize it.

The solution to this risky situation is to simply start a proper exercise program that works the muscular system so that fats and sugars are burnt up in the muscle cells before they can do harm.
